    Clarrie,

    Could this be your Thomas in 1851?

    Census: 1851: HO107/1581 Folio ?? Page ??
    Address: 4 Dungate or Hungate, Camberwell, Surrey
    -- Thomas GARD Head Mar 40 Ostler at a Livery Stables [born] Hampshire NK

    -- Elizabeth Do Wife Mar 34 Seamstress [born] Surrey Camberwell
    -- Olivia or Media [hard to read] MARTIN or MARIN Step Daur U 20 Do [born] Do Do

    Hi everyone. Thanks for your information.

    Unfortunately, I forgot to add a date to my original message.

    Thomas was in Australia before 1851 British Census but he was an accomplished clown and equestrian with circus' travelling in Australia during the 1840s and we have wondered if he was involved with carnivals, circus work etc. in England or Ireland before he came to Australia. He was born 1823 in Cork apparently.
